Grant Description

Background Heart failure (HF) is a common disease with high mortality and morbidity especially in combination with severe chronic kidney disease (CKD). Virtually all major studies in HF exclude patients with  severe CKD.

Eplerenone is one of the main therapies in HF.Aim The overall aim is to build a research network to study HF therapies in patients with HF in combination with severe CKD. The main trial is a randomized open label trial of eplerenone vs usual care.
